The Basics: What is Viagra?
For those who might be unaware (perhaps living under a rock, right?), Viagra, or sildenafil, is a medication designed to treat erectile dysfunction (ED). It works by increasing blood flow to the penis, helping to achieve and maintain an erection when combined with sexual stimulation. Since its introduction in the late 1990s, it has become quite the household name (or at least a go-to topic for men at the bar). But while the benefits are clear, the legalities can be murky.
The Law Says…
In the United States and many other countries, Viagra is classified as a prescription medication. This means it should ideally be prescribed by a healthcare professional after assessing the individual’s health and medical history. Why? Because not everyone is suitable for this treatment.
